HTML帮助文件的制作和使用

HTML Help Workshop 已经不是新鲜的东西 , 它取代了功能很强但看起来比较普通的 Help Workshop 4.0 。HTML Help Workshop 编译之后生成扩展名为 .chm 的文件 , 在 Windows 中它被称为“已编译的 HTML 帮助文件” 。这种文件格式在网上广为流传 , 被称为一种电子书籍格式 。HTML Help Workshop 的特点在于 , 它的每一个帮助页都是一个Web页 , 您可以像浏览网站一样容易地阅读 HTML 帮助文件 。HTML 帮助文件甚至支持 ActiveX, JavaScrip, VBScrip 和 Dll 等 。HTML帮助文件类似资源管理器的窗口的浏览方式 , 使用极其方便 。
我相信大家都已经习惯了使用HTML帮助文件(.CHM) , 不再习惯使用原来的Help帮助文件(.HLP)了――用惯了 MSDN , 你还想看 BCB 的帮助文档吗?所以当你再看到扩展名为.HLP文件的时候 , 你肯定会因为它的使用不便而将它弃之一旁……够了 , 就凭这些 , 我们也应该把 Help Wordshop 抛在一边了 , 让我们来学习 HTML 帮助文件的制作和使用吧 。
HTML Help Workshop 包括在 Visual Studio 6 中 , 不过那是 1.1 版本的 。现在最新版本是 1.3 。但如果有条件的话 , 你一定要在下述站点去查看一下有否最新的版本:
http://msdn.microsoft.com/library/en-s/htmlhelp/html/hwMicrosoftHTMLHelpDownloads.asp
【HTML帮助文件的制作和使用】要制作一个 HTML 帮助文件 , HTML Help Workshop 准备好了吗?好 , 让我们先了解几种文件:
HTML帮助项目文件(.HHP)
编译源文件――HTML文件(.HTM) 。
如果你需要加上索引功能 , 那么还要一个HTML帮助索引文件(.HHK) 。
加上HTML帮助目录文件(.HHC)后 , 你就可以方便的选择帮助主题了 。
你还需要创建上下文件相关的帮助吗?那么再加一个C/C语言头文件(.H)吧!
其实需要的东西并不多 , 而且除C/C语言头文件外 , 其它文件均可由HTML Help Workshop创建;而C/C语言头文件随便用一种文本编辑器都可以创建 , HTML Help Workshop也能 , 只是需要更改扩展名 。
下面 , 学习开始:

创建工程项目(HTML Help Project)
工具栏(Toolbar)介绍
往项目中添加主题文件(Topic Files)
设置工程选项(Project Options)
为帮助文件添加目录(Contents)和索引(Index)
为帮助文件设计窗口样式(Window style)
允许全文搜索(Full Text Search)的 HTML 帮助
上下文相关(Context-Sensitive)的 HTML 帮助
在 Visual Basic 6 中使用 HTML 帮助
在 Visual C6 中使用 HTML 帮助
多个 HTML 帮助文件的合并(Merge) 运用

    推荐阅读